PHP
PHP (hypertext preprocessor) to popularny skryptowy język programowania działający po stronie serwera. Jest używany głównie do tworzenia dynamicznych stron internetowych i aplikacji webowych. Pozwala na generowanie treści HTML, interakcję z bazami danych, zarządzanie plikami i wykonywanie wielu innych operacji w tle, zanim strona zostanie wyświetlona w przeglądarce użytkownika.
Jak działa?
-
PHP działa na serwerze, czyli wykonuje kod jeszcze przed wysłaniem wyniku do przeglądarki użytkownika.
-
Kod PHP jest osadzony w plikach HTML i po uruchomieniu generuje treść dynamiczną.
-
Odpowiada za przetwarzanie formularzy, komunikację z bazami danych (np. MySQL), zarządzanie sesjami użytkowników i obsługę plików.
-
Na serwerze zainstalowany jest interpreter PHP, który przetwarza kod i wysyła wynik w formie HTML do przeglądarki.
-
PHP może być zintegrowany z różnymi bazami danych i serwerami, co czyni go wszechstronnym narzędziem do budowy aplikacji webowych.
Dlaczego jest ważne?
-
Szerokie zastosowanie: PHP jest podstawą wielu popularnych systemów zarządzania treścią (CMS), takich jak WordPress, Joomla czy Drupal.
-
Elastyczność i skalowalność: umożliwia tworzenie prostych stron internetowych, jak i zaawansowanych aplikacji webowych.
-
Integracja z bazami danych: PHP pozwala na łatwe połączenie z bazami danych, co jest kluczowe dla aplikacji opartych na dynamicznych treściach.
-
Społeczność i wsparcie: ogromna społeczność programistów i mnóstwo dostępnych zasobów edukacyjnych sprawia, że PHP jest łatwy do nauki i rozwoju.
-
Szybkość działania: wydajność i szybkość przetwarzania kodu na serwerze sprawiają, że PHP jest idealnym wyborem dla stron o dużym ruchu.
Przykład praktyczny
PHP może być używane do tworzenia dynamicznej strony z listą produktów. Gdy użytkownik odwiedza stronę sklepu, PHP łączy się z bazą danych, pobiera listę dostępnych produktów, a następnie generuje kod HTML, który wyświetla produkty wraz z cenami i opisami. Kiedy użytkownik dodaje produkt do koszyka, PHP zapisuje te dane, zarządza sesją użytkownika i przetwarza zamówienie. Dzięki temu strona dynamicznie reaguje na działania użytkownika, aktualizując dane w czasie rzeczywistym.
Zatrudnij eksperta
Chcesz rozwijać swój biznes e-commerce i maksymalizować jego potencjał? Rozważ zatrudnienie eksperta ds. e-commerce, który poprowadzi Cię przez zawiłości sprzedaży online i pomoże Ci osiągnąć cele biznesowe.
Skontaktuj się z nami!Fraza wyszukiwania
Szukasz wiedzy?
Skorzystaj z wyszukiwarki
-
C
-
D
-
E
-
G
-
H
-
I
-
J
-
K
-
L
-
M
-
P
-
R
-
S
-
T
-
U
-
W